你知道梯度提升树机器学习的一个很好的库吗?最好是:具有良好的算法,如AdaBoost、TreeBoost、AnyBoost、LogitBoost等具有可配置的弱分类器能够进行分类和预测(回归)具有各种允许的信号:数字、类别或自由文本C/C++或Python开源到目前为止我找到了http://www.multiboost.org/home看起来不错。但是我想知道是否还有其他库? 最佳答案 如果您正在寻找python版本,最新版本scikit-learn具有用于分类和回归的梯度增强回归树(docs)。它类似于R的gbm包-gbm对于(最
你知道梯度提升树机器学习的一个很好的库吗?最好是:具有良好的算法,如AdaBoost、TreeBoost、AnyBoost、LogitBoost等具有可配置的弱分类器能够进行分类和预测(回归)具有各种允许的信号:数字、类别或自由文本C/C++或Python开源到目前为止我找到了http://www.multiboost.org/home看起来不错。但是我想知道是否还有其他库? 最佳答案 如果您正在寻找python版本,最新版本scikit-learn具有用于分类和回归的梯度增强回归树(docs)。它类似于R的gbm包-gbm对于(最
我想解析一个html页面并从中提取有意义的文本。任何人都知道一些好的算法来做到这一点?我在Rails上开发我的应用程序,但我认为ruby在这方面有点慢,所以我认为如果在c中存在一些好的库,那将是合适的。谢谢!!PD:请不要用java推荐任何东西更新:我找到了这个linktext遗憾的是,是在python中 最佳答案 使用Nokogiri,速度很快,用C语言编写,适用于Ruby。(使用正则表达式来解析像HTML这样的递归表达式是notoriouslydifficultanderrorprone,我不会走那条路。我只在答案中提到这一
我想解析一个html页面并从中提取有意义的文本。任何人都知道一些好的算法来做到这一点?我在Rails上开发我的应用程序,但我认为ruby在这方面有点慢,所以我认为如果在c中存在一些好的库,那将是合适的。谢谢!!PD:请不要用java推荐任何东西更新:我找到了这个linktext遗憾的是,是在python中 最佳答案 使用Nokogiri,速度很快,用C语言编写,适用于Ruby。(使用正则表达式来解析像HTML这样的递归表达式是notoriouslydifficultanderrorprone,我不会走那条路。我只在答案中提到这一
我对取消转义文本很感兴趣,例如:\映射到C中的\。有人知道一个好的库吗?作为引用维基百科ListofXMLandHTMLCharacterEntityReferences. 最佳答案 对于C中解码这些HTML实体的另一个开源引用,您可以查看命令行实用程序uni2ascii/ascii2uni。相关文件是用于实体查找的enttbl.{c,h}和从UTF32向下转换为UTF8的putu8.c。uni2ascii 关于html-如何在C中解码HTML实体?,我们在StackOverflow上找
我对取消转义文本很感兴趣,例如:\映射到C中的\。有人知道一个好的库吗?作为引用维基百科ListofXMLandHTMLCharacterEntityReferences. 最佳答案 对于C中解码这些HTML实体的另一个开源引用,您可以查看命令行实用程序uni2ascii/ascii2uni。相关文件是用于实体查找的enttbl.{c,h}和从UTF32向下转换为UTF8的putu8.c。uni2ascii 关于html-如何在C中解码HTML实体?,我们在StackOverflow上找
我必须为iOS应用程序中的特定C库提供C风格的回调。回调没有void*userData或类似的东西。所以我无法在上下文中循环。我想避免引入全局上下文来解决这个问题。理想的解决方案是Objective-Cblock。我的问题:有没有办法将block“转换”为函数指针或以某种方式包装/隐藏它? 最佳答案 从技术上讲,您可以访问该block的函数指针。但是这样做是完全不安全的,所以我当然不推荐这样做。要了解如何操作,请考虑以下示例:#importstructBlock_layout{void*isa;intflags;intreserve
我必须为iOS应用程序中的特定C库提供C风格的回调。回调没有void*userData或类似的东西。所以我无法在上下文中循环。我想避免引入全局上下文来解决这个问题。理想的解决方案是Objective-Cblock。我的问题:有没有办法将block“转换”为函数指针或以某种方式包装/隐藏它? 最佳答案 从技术上讲,您可以访问该block的函数指针。但是这样做是完全不安全的,所以我当然不推荐这样做。要了解如何操作,请考虑以下示例:#importstructBlock_layout{void*isa;intflags;intreserve
我在iOS应用程序和Android应用程序中重用旧版C库。我想自定义一些宏定义(例如用于日志记录)。是否有标准定义来检查(使用#ifdef)代码是针对iOS还是Android/NDK编译的? 最佳答案 __ANDROID__或ANDROIDforAndroid(使用NDK编译)和Apple平台(iOS或OSX)上的__APPLE__ 关于android-如何确定C代码是为Android/NDK还是iOS编译的,我们在StackOverflow上找到一个类似的问题:
我在iOS应用程序和Android应用程序中重用旧版C库。我想自定义一些宏定义(例如用于日志记录)。是否有标准定义来检查(使用#ifdef)代码是针对iOS还是Android/NDK编译的? 最佳答案 __ANDROID__或ANDROIDforAndroid(使用NDK编译)和Apple平台(iOS或OSX)上的__APPLE__ 关于android-如何确定C代码是为Android/NDK还是iOS编译的,我们在StackOverflow上找到一个类似的问题: